Format of the IFSC Code BARB0TRDNIT
The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Bank Of Baroda, has an 11-character structure:
AAAA0CCCCCC
Here's the breakdown:
- First 4 characters (AAAA): Show the bank code. For Bank Of Baroda, these letters represent the bank's short name.
- 5th character: Is always zero and is kept for future use.
-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Chowk Market Branch in Faridabad.
For example, the IFSC Code BARB0TRDNIT of Bank Of Baroda for the Chowk Market Branch branch includes these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Faridabad and Haryana correctly.

How to Use IFSC Code BARB0TRDNIT for Online Transfers?
Once you have the IFSC Code BARB0TRDNIT for the Chowk Market Branch branch of Bank Of Baroda in Faridabad,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:
NEFT
Add beneficiary details including the name, account number, and IFSC Code BARB0TRDNIT. Transfers are processed in batches. This is suitable for personal and business payments.
RTGS
Used for high-value pay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.
IMPS
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and Bank Of Baroda IFSC Code BARB0TRDNIT.
Regardless of the method you choose, the accuracy of the IFSC Code is crucial. Any mistake in entering the IFSC Code for Bank Of Baroda Chowk Market Branch in Faridabad may result in delayed or failed transactions.
